Package Details: lollypop-git 0.9.244.r67.ga77dff23-1

Git Clone URL: (read-only)
Package Base: lollypop-git
Description: Lollypop is a new GNOME music playing application.
Upstream URL:
Keywords: gnome music player
Licenses: GPL3
Conflicts: lollypop
Provides: lollypop
Submitter: brunelli
Maintainer: krakn
Last Packager: krakn
Votes: 18
Popularity: 0.884979
First Submitted: 2014-10-15 19:04
Last Updated: 2017-09-14 14:51

Latest Comments

FredBezies commented on 2017-07-05 15:14

PKGBUILD updated.

bil-elmoussaoui commented on 2017-07-05 13:53

The master branch now uses meson instead of autotools:
the autotools deps should be replaced with
- meson
- ninja
- appstream-glib

FredBezies commented on 2017-04-21 05:33

@Pointedstick : thanks for the info. PKGBUILD adapted :)

Pointedstick commented on 2017-04-21 04:37

There are additional optional dependencies:

lollypop-portal easytag kid3-cli

bmbaker commented on 2017-04-18 11:13

keeps crashing!

~ $ lollypop
/usr/lib/python3.6/site-packages/gi/ Warning: g_array_append_vals: assertion 'array' failed
g_type = info.get_g_type()
/usr/lib/python3.6/site-packages/gi/ Warning: g_hash_table_lookup: assertion 'hash_table != NULL' failed
g_type = info.get_g_type()
/usr/lib/python3.6/site-packages/gi/ Warning: g_hash_table_insert_internal: assertion 'hash_table != NULL' failed
g_type = info.get_g_type()

(lollypop:20178): GLib-GIO-ERROR **: Settings schema 'org.gnome.Lollypop' does not contain a key named 'music-uris'
Trace/breakpoint trap (core dumped)

DeathKhan commented on 2017-02-01 03:31

Now crashes
since latest update

gnumdk commented on 2016-12-19 13:31

Lollypop depends on

It's optional.

FredBezies commented on 2016-12-09 18:36

@gnumdk : fixed :)

gnumdk commented on 2016-12-09 08:53

/usr/share/lollypop/lollypop-sp needs to be +x

gnumdk commented on 2016-10-25 15:19

Lollypop doesn't depend explicitly on pylast...

FredBezies commented on 2016-10-06 06:13

@archdria : fixed. Thanks.

arrufat commented on 2016-10-05 17:16

@FredBezies yes, I meant python-pylast, sorry.
But it's no longer optional...

FredBezies commented on 2016-10-05 05:45

@ærchdria : is python-pylast not enough ?

arrufat commented on 2016-10-04 11:39

It now depends explicitly on python-lastfm.

FredBezies commented on 2016-09-28 08:01

@Terence : Lollypop is gstreamer 1.x based. Gst-fluendo-mp3 is 0.10.x based, so not used at all here.

"Depends on

gtk3 >= 3.14
gir1.2-gstreamer-1.0 (Debian)"

And if you look at

dep: libgstreamer1.0-0 (>= 1.4.0)

If you want mp3 support, the working option is to use gst-plugins-bad package.

Terence commented on 2016-09-20 22:17

Please add gst-fluendo-mp3 (AUR) as an optional dependency.

bitseater commented on 2016-07-08 19:10

In fact, according to the developer, it seems it's out of date:

rob2uk commented on 2016-07-07 22:57

Please refrain from marking packages as 'out of date' if they are not, in fact, out of date. Thanks.

yoseforb commented on 2015-06-16 12:34

Please, added python-wikipedia as depends.

brunelli commented on 2015-05-25 15:39

@yoseforb: I'm adding it as an optional dependency.

yoseforb commented on 2015-05-25 06:25

Please, added 'python-pylast' as a depends.

kitaro commented on 2015-05-15 23:40


thanks for your concern. i solved it by removing the contents of my Music directory.

it's strange, i don't know why it failed to load.

brunelli commented on 2015-05-12 17:17


> tried building from git source manually, the problem still occurs.

Well, then you should try opening an issue upstream, not here.

I've just installed here and it's working perfectly, but if you still can't launch it, open an issue here:

kitaro commented on 2015-05-12 12:52

lollypop crashed upon launching, forced to close.

Unhandled exception in thread started by <bound method CollectionScanner._scan of <CollectionScanner object at 0x7f4a10c46ab0 (lollypop+collectionscanner+CollectionScanner at 0x7f4a2808f5a0)>>
Traceback (most recent call last):
File "/usr/local/lib/python3.4/site-packages/lollypop/", line 207, in _scan
(new_tracks, new_dirs, count) = self._get_objects_for_paths(paths)
File "/usr/local/lib/python3.4/site-packages/lollypop/", line 112, in _get_objects_for_paths
f = Gio.File.new_for_path(filepath)
UnicodeEncodeError: 'utf-8' codec can't encode character '\udca4' in position 33: surrogates not allowed
Exception ignored in: <module 'threading' from '/usr/lib/python3.4/'>
Traceback (most recent call last):
File "/usr/lib/python3.4/", line 1296, in _shutdown
File "/usr/lib/python3.4/", line 1019, in _delete
del _active[get_ident()]
KeyError: 139955938522880

tried building from git source manually, the problem still occurs.

gnumdk commented on 2015-03-27 12:17

Missing deps:
- totem-plparser
- gobject-introspection

brunelli commented on 2015-03-25 14:45

@gnumdk Just updated the PKGBUILD :)

gnumdk commented on 2015-03-25 14:17

You can remove mutagen from deps, not needed anymore...

brunelli commented on 2014-10-27 16:23

If updating and the program fails to open, please remove the file $HOME/.local/share/lollypop/lollypop.db and try to open the program again.

brunelli commented on 2014-10-20 18:04

@FredBezies Done. Thanks for the tip!

FredBezies commented on 2014-10-16 21:13

Please add gnome-common to makedepends

"which: no in (/usr/local/sbin:/usr/local/bin:/usr/bin:/usr/bin/site_perl:/usr/bin/vendor_perl:/usr/bin/core_perl)
You need to install gnome-common from GNOME Git (or from
your OS vendor's package manager)."